I'm a little bit surprised that the helis, after all these years, still need tweaks to behave better. For instance, the Trex 500 is crazy touchy on collective at the hover points. The pitch and throttle curves needed to be set for flattened-out 3/8 & 5/8 (shhhh!) stick hover points. But then with that done, she flies really nice, much more in tune with a good setup on a real model. A beginner shouldn't have to figure that out.

That said, it's REALLY nice to see that there's still a good heli sim available and that it runs on Windows 10.
